It works with all of them I have concluded. SO… if you want, you can kill rykard, and still do the assassinations after. But only as long as you don’t talk to the people in the manor after I assume. (Also I didn’t do the final letter quest tho I just sent straight for rykard through the manor)
Question for some of you Elden Ring players. If I talk to patches and already have his letter, can I kill Rykard first and then go back and kill tragoth? I know you have to talk to patches before killing rykard but I was just wondering if I could talk to him, kill rykard, and then kill tragoth.

Question for some of you Elden Ring players. If I talk to patches and already have his letter, can I kill Rykard first and then go back and kill tragoth? I know you have to talk to patches before killing rykard but I was just wondering if I could talk to him, kill rykard, and then kill tragoth.


Ok soooo, I managed to do it. Turns out if you pick up the letter from patches, kill rykard, DONT go back to the manor and tell everyone you did it, and then kill tragoth, you still get the armor. I assume this works for the other assassinations letters as well but I haven’t tested it.
